When was the Bath Tune Up trademark registered?

Bath_Tune_Up Franchise · 2025 FDD

Answer from 2025 FDD Document

REGISTRATION NUMBER MARK REGISTRATION DATE
Registration No. 6548366 BATH TUNE∙UP Registered November 2, 2021
Registration No. 6713108 Registered April 26, 2022

Source: Item 13 — TRADEMARKS (FDD pages 36–37)

What This Means (2025 FDD)

According to Bath Tune Up's 2025 Franchise Disclosure Document, the Bath Tune Up trademark was registered on November 2, 2021. The document specifies that the trademark, identified by Registration No. 6548366, is registered with the United States Patent and Trademark Office.

This registration provides Bath Tune Up with legal protection of its brand name and logo, preventing unauthorized use by other businesses. As a franchisee, you are granted the right to operate your business under these trademarks, but you must adhere to Bath Tune Up's guidelines for their use. This includes using the marks in authorized ways and notifying Bath Tune Up of any potential infringements.

The FDD also mentions that Bath Tune Up has the right to modify or discontinue the use of their marks, and as a franchisee, you would be obligated to comply with these changes at your own expense. Additionally, franchisees are prohibited from contesting Bath Tune Up's rights to their trademarks. Bath Tune Up will defend franchisees against claims arising from authorized use of the marks, except for claims by prior users of the name "BATH TUNE-UP®".
